The one thing Mrs. Bennett most dearly wants is to see her five daughters settled. When wealthy bachelor Mr. Bingley moves in to nearby Netherfield Hall and takes an interest in her eldest daughter, Jane, her dream is almost within her grasp. Yet, problems arise when Bingley's friend, the prideful Mr. Darcy, meddles in their relationship, earning him the disdain of Jane's sister, Elizabeth. However, Mr. Darcy can't help finding a match in the intelligent, free-spirited Lizzy Bennett, despite her country manners.

No matter what the options are, Mike, a rough-tongued, reclusive southerner, with little patience for people, would rather be fishing. Every time he puts his hand on his rod, the phone rings with a new job to exterminate a monster. Rather Be Fishing follows Mike on nine such delays as he battles a range of challenging creatures. His clients find themselves plagued by everything from well-known foes like vampires and werewolves to more rare nuisances like moss men and chupacabra.

I was really sad when this book came to an end. The characters had become like good friends and I just wanted the book to keep going so I could hang out with them. Nathan Glondys does a great job giving each character a distinct voice that is perfect for them. And, Lucretia Stanhope did a lovely job in the writing. The characters have life and depth and are well worth listening to. I also like the format. Each chapter became a short monster story that when taken together becomes a snapshot in the life of this monster hunter. Well done.

What if Jane Austen's most notorious character, Lady Susan Vernon, paid a special visit to Lady Catherine de Bourgh at her grand estate of Rosings Park? Her arrival inadvertently occurs right after Elizabeth Bennet has rejected Mr. Darcy's botched proposal, and the saddened gentleman catches the eye of London's most infamous flirt. The fun begins as Lady Susan plots to sever Darcy from Elizabeth, and claim him for herself. We all know she can't possibly win his heart, but it is a bit of a giggle to watch her try.

This is a lovely story. The author has written it in such a way that you can enjoy the book whether you are familiar with the characters or not. It is a departure from the original Pride and Prejudice cannon, but it wraps up some characters nicely that I have always wanted to have a better ending to their story. The narrator does a nice job. She sounds a little sleepy at times, but she carries the story well. This is a light romance that is pleasant to listen to.

When Emma opens her own salon at last, she is beyond thrilled. It has taken four years of saving and planning to get here, and she even managed to leave her old salon on good terms with her former boss, Gina. Emma is on top of the world. Until someone is murdered right in front of her apartment, that is. The woman is a tourist with zero connections in town, and there is no reason at all that anyone should have killed her; unless you count the fact that she looks remarkably like Emma.
